Choose the Right Camera for the Job
Selecting the appropriate underwater inspection camera is crucial for the success of your underwater inspection project. Consider factors such as depth rating, camera resolution, lighting capabilities, cable length, and maneuverability when choosing a camera. For shallow water inspections, a basic camera with lower resolution may suffice, while deeper dives may require a high-definition camera with better lighting options. It is essential to match the camera specifications with the specific requirements of your inspection task to ensure clear and accurate footage.
Inspect and Maintain Equipment Regularly
Before every underwater inspection, it is essential to inspect the camera equipment thoroughly to ensure proper functioning and to identify any potential issues. Check for any signs of damage, such as cracks in the housing, frayed cables, or malfunctioning lights. It is crucial to address any problems immediately to prevent equipment failures during the inspection. Additionally, regularly clean and maintain the camera and its accessories according to the manufacturer's instructions to extend their lifespan and ensure optimal performance.
Understand Depth and Pressure Limits
One of the primary safety concerns when using underwater inspection cameras is the depth and pressure limits of the equipment. Exceeding the maximum depth rating of the camera can lead to water leakage, loss of functionality, or irreversible damage. It is crucial to understand the depth limitations of your camera and avoid diving beyond its safe operating range. Additionally, be aware of the pressure changes that occur as you descend deeper underwater and take necessary precautions to prevent equipment failure due to pressure-related issues.
Secure Cables and Equipment Properly
Proper cable management is essential when using underwater inspection cameras to prevent entanglement, snags, or damage to the equipment. Secure the cables and camera housing to a stable platform or attachment point using reliable clips, tethers, or mounts. Avoid allowing the cables to drag along the seabed or get caught on underwater obstacles. By securing the equipment properly, you can minimize the risk of cable damage, loss of communication, or interference with the inspection process.
Monitor Battery Life and Power Supply
Battery life is a critical factor to consider when using underwater inspection cameras, as power supply issues can disrupt or prematurely end an inspection. Monitor the battery levels regularly during underwater inspections and replace or recharge them as needed to ensure continuous operation. Always carry extra batteries or a backup power source to avoid unexpected power failures. Additionally, check the integrity of the electrical connections and ensure that the power supply to the camera is stable and reliable throughout the inspection.
